Question:

In a circle of radius $5\text{ cm}$, two parallel chords of lengths $6\text{ cm}$ and $8\text{ cm}$ are drawn on opposite sides of the centre. Find the distance between the two chords.

Step-by-Step Solution

Key Concept: Distance of $6\text{ cm}$ chord from centre $= \sqrt{5^2 - 3^2} = 4\text{ cm}$. Distance of $8\text{ cm}$ chord from centre $= \sqrt{5^2 - 4^2} = 3\text{ cm}$. Total distance $= 4 + 3 = 7\text{ cm}$.
Distance of $6\text{ cm}$ chord $= \sqrt{25 - 9} = 4\text{ cm}$. [1.0 Mark]
Distance of $8\text{ cm}$ chord $= \sqrt{25 - 16} = 3\text{ cm}$. [1.0 Mark]
Total distance $= 4 + 3 = 7\text{ cm}$. [1.0 Mark]
